It’s the season to eat cowpea. Let’s have a cold cowpea. The recipe is simple, delicious and convenient."

Cowpeas in Cold Dressing

1. Cut the cowpea into small sections, put it in water, blanch it and remove it.

2. Put it in cold water, several times in cold water to keep the cowpea green

3. Remove the controlled water and put it into a basin, add appropriate amount of light soy sauce, vinegar, salt, and dried red pepper. Mince garlic and put on top

4. Put an appropriate amount of vegetable oil in the pot, heat it up, add the peppercorns and fry them until fragrant, remove the peppercorns

5. Pour the pepper oil on the minced garlic and chili

6. Stir well and serve.
